Physiological Response of Avicennia marina to Salinity and Recovery

Z. Barhoumi et al.

Summary: Avicennia marina can survive under high salinity conditions and enhances salt excretion, water use efficiency, and photosynthetic activity under high salinity. The recovery process does not have significant benefits on growth, water status, and ion leakage, but can enhance photosynthetic activity.
